Ce composant vient enrichir l\u2019offre de Mouser en capteurs de pr\u00e9cision pour les environnements industriels s\u00e9v\u00e8res.<\/p>\n<p>Con\u00e7u pour offrir une stabilit\u00e9 et une exactitude \u00e9lev\u00e9es sur le long terme, le SCA3400\u2011D01 combine robustesse m\u00e9canique, faible bruit et excellente lin\u00e9arit\u00e9, m\u00eame en pr\u00e9sence de variations de temp\u00e9rature et dans des conditions d\u2019exploitation difficiles.<\/p>\n<h4>Des performances de mesure adapt\u00e9es aux environnements industriels s\u00e9v\u00e8res<\/h4>\n<p>L\u2019acc\u00e9l\u00e9rom\u00e8tre SCA3400\u2011D01 se distingue par une stabilit\u00e9 exceptionnelle de l\u2019offset sur la dur\u00e9e de vie du produit. La d\u00e9rive d\u2019offset est limit\u00e9e \u00e0 0,5 mg sur les axes X et Y et \u00e0 2 mg sur l\u2019axe Z, tandis que l\u2019erreur d\u2019offset induite par la temp\u00e9rature reste contenue \u00e0 2 mg sur les axes X et Y et 3 mg sur l\u2019axe Z.<\/p>\n<p>En termes de pr\u00e9cision, le capteur pr\u00e9sente une erreur de lin\u00e9arit\u00e9 de seulement 1 mg sur une plage de \u00b11,2 g, associ\u00e9e \u00e0 une densit\u00e9 de bruit de 20 \u00b5g\/\u221aHz. Ces caract\u00e9ristiques permettent d\u2019obtenir des mesures fiables et reproductibles, essentielles pour les applications de surveillance continue et de contr\u00f4le pr\u00e9cis.<\/p>\n<h4>Une technologie MEMS \u00e9prouv\u00e9e et des fonctions int\u00e9gr\u00e9es<\/h4>\n<p>Bas\u00e9 sur une technologie MEMS capacitive 3D \u00e9prouv\u00e9e, le SCA3400\u2011D01 int\u00e8gre plusieurs fonctions destin\u00e9es \u00e0 faciliter son utilisation dans des syst\u00e8mes industriels complexes. Il propose notamment une plage dynamique s\u00e9lectionnable par l\u2019utilisateur, des filtres passe\u2011bas int\u00e9gr\u00e9s, ainsi que des fonctions d\u2019auto\u2011diagnostic contribuant \u00e0 la fiabilit\u00e9 globale du syst\u00e8me.<\/p>\n<p>Cette approche permet aux concepteurs de simplifier l\u2019architecture des syst\u00e8mes de mesure inertielle tout en garantissant un haut niveau de confiance dans les donn\u00e9es collect\u00e9es.<\/p>\n<h4>Applications cibl\u00e9es<\/h4>\n<p>L\u2019acc\u00e9l\u00e9rom\u00e8tre Murata SCA3400\u2011D01 s\u2019adresse principalement aux applications de surveillance structurelle, de commande de machines industrielles, d\u2019outils et syst\u00e8mes pour le secteur de la construction, ainsi qu\u2019aux unit\u00e9s de mesure inertielle (IMU) n\u00e9cessitant une grande stabilit\u00e9 dans le temps.<\/p>\n<p><em>Pour les ing\u00e9nieurs et int\u00e9grateurs de syst\u00e8mes industriels, la disponibilit\u00e9 du SCA3400\u2011D01 chez Mouser facilite l\u2019acc\u00e8s \u00e0 un capteur inertiel de tr\u00e8s haute stabilit\u00e9, adapt\u00e9 aux applications de surveillance \u00e0 long terme et aux environnements difficiles.
